1.  Please make sure that the format of your input files is correct.  You
can check this by graphing your data.  WeatherMan has a very nice graphing
utility.

2.  Use at least five years of historical weather data to generate climate
files.  20-30 years is better.

3.  Alpha will be 0 if you have NO RAIN for a given month for ALL years of
input

4.  Definitions of Alpha can be found in the WEATHER.CDE file that is part
of DSSAT v3.5

5.  Also, check the WM documentation of DSSAT



At 04:13 AM 2/15/2001 +0000, you wrote:
>Does anyone know that while generating ".cli" files from observed weather
>why the value of alpha comes out to be zero for some months,
>even when the data format is correct.
